There are 20 retirement homes near San Marino, California. The costs per day for retirment home living in California range from $18 to $165, with a median cost running around $69. The per month expense averages around $2,062 and ranges between $542 and $4,950. On an annual basis, the mean cost is about $24,750, which is higher than the national average of $23,100.
Costs for retirement home care in San Marino generally range between $557 per month and $4,675 per month. The median cost is around $2,090 per month, or around $25,080 per year.
San Marino is a small city in Los Angeles County, California. It is included in the Los Angeles metropolitan area. The encompassing statistical area is home to 7,287,303 people, but there are 13,361 residing within the city itself. Around 33% of the local populace are 55 and over.
The SeniorScore™ for San Marino is 94. The city has a median per capita income of $79,000. The median household income is $158,000 versus an average of $52,000 for the state of California. The current unemployment rate is approximately 3.84% and the median housing price is $750,000, which is significantly higher than the California average of $451,500.
San Marino has ideal mean temperatures, with very mild winters and very temperate summers. The area receives optimal amounts of rainfall annually. In relation to other cities in the US, San Marino has a very low rate of crime, poor water quality ratings, and very poor air quality ratings.
